Vibe- Event Discovery & Booking Platform with Admin Panel & Merchant Verification

Sometimes Envato’s live preview system temporarily breaks links. Please use the direct demo link with credentials mentioned below : LIVE DEMO – Try Before You

Mar 24, 2026 - 18:18
Apr 5, 2026 - 13:15
 0  2
Vibe- Event Discovery & Booking Platform with Admin Panel & Merchant Verification

Sometimes Envato’s live preview system temporarily breaks links. Please use the direct demo link with credentials mentioned below :

LIVE DEMO – Try Before You Buy!

Live Application: VIBE

Demo Credentials:>

Merchant Demo Credentials:> Merchant Login

Admin Demo Credentials:> Admin Login

SVG 01 SVG 06 SVG 03 SVG 04 SVG 05

Overview

Vibe is a sophisticated, production-ready Lifestyle and Travel Booking Platform designed to empower merchants and delight users. Built with the latest Next.js 14 and MongoDB, this application provides a seamless end-to-end solution for discovering and booking Events, Movies, Sports, and Activities, alongside an integrated AI Trip Planner. With a polished, responsive design and robust features like QR code check-in, secure Stripe payments, and real-time analytics, Vibe is the perfect foundation for your multi-service marketplace or startup.

⚠️ Important: External API Costs Disclaimer

Please note that this application relies on external third-party services which may incur costs based on your usage.

  • Stripe – Standard transaction fees apply for processing payments and payouts.
  • Cloudinary – Used for storing images and user avatars. A generous free tier is available.
  • MongoDB Atlas – Database hosting. A free tier (M0) is available for development.
  • Email Service (SMTP) – Requires an SMTP provider (like Gmail, SendGrid, or AWS SES) for transactional emails.
  • OpenAI (Optional) – Required for AI Trip Planner functionality (standard API usage fees apply).

The purchase price of this application covers the source code only. You are responsible for configuring and maintaining these external service accounts.

Key Features

For Merchants

  • Intuitive Dashboard: Get a bird’s-eye view of your sales, revenue, and bookings in real-time.
  • Multi-Category Listings: Create pages for Events, Movie Screenings, Sports Matches, and Activities.
  • Flexible Ticketing: Define multiple ticket tiers (e.g., Early Bird, VIP, General Admission) with specific prices and quantity limits.
  • Attendee Management: View a comprehensive list of all ticket holders and their check-in status.
  • Scanner Compatible: Verify tickets easily using the unique QR code on every ticket.

For Users

  • Unified Discovery: Browse Events, Movies, Sports, and Activities in one place.
  • AI Trip Planner: Generate personalized travel itineraries with destination and activity suggestions.
  • Seamless Booking: Select tickets and checkout securely in seconds.
  • Digital Wallet: Access purchased tickets anytime in a dedicated “My Tickets” wallet section.
  • QR Code Check-in: Each ticket generates a unique secure QR code for instant verify-at-the-door entry.

For Admins

  • Platform Ownership: Manage all users and merchants from a central panel.
  • Revenue Tracking: Monitor total platform earnings and merchant payouts.
  • Merchant Approval: Review and approve new merchant registrations to ensure quality.

Technical Highlights

  • Modern Tech Stack: Built with Next.js 14 (App Router), React, and Tailwind CSS for high performance and SEO.
  • Secure Authentication: Custom JWT-based authentication system with hashed passwords (bcrypt).
  • Image Optimization: Automatic image optimization and delivery via Cloudinary.
  • Responsive Design: Fully responsive UI that works perfectly on desktops, tablets, and mobile devices.
  • Payment Integration: Full Stripe integration for secure payments and payouts.

Technical Specifications

Technology Stack

  • Frontend: Next.js 14, React, Tailwind CSS
  • Backend: Next.js API Routes (Serverless)
  • Database: MongoDB (Mongoose ODM)
  • Authentication: JWT (JSON Web Tokens)
  • Payments: Stripe (Checkout & Connect)
  • Storage: Cloudinary
  • Emails: Nodemailer
  • QR Codes: qrcode.react
  • AI: OpenAI API (for Trip Planner)

System Requirements

  • Node.js 18.x or higher
  • MongoDB Database (Atlas or Local)
  • Stripe Account
  • Cloudinary Account
  • SMTP Server Credentials
  • OpenAI API Key (for Trip Planner features)

Installation and Setup

The package includes detailed, easy-to-follow documentation to help you get started quickly.

  • Step-by-Step Installation: Guides for local development and deployment.
  • Environment Configuration: Instructions for setting up .env.local for all API keys.
  • Service Setup: Dedicated guides for getting keys from Stripe, Cloudinary, and OpenAI.
  • Customization: How to change branding colors, logos, and business logic.

What’s Included

  • Full Source Code: 100% accessible logic, ready to customize.
  • Documentation: Comprehensive guides covering setup and features.
  • Deployment Ready: Pre-configured for easy deployment to Vercel or standard Node.js environments.
  • Future Updates: Free updates for bugs and compatibility improvements.

Support

We are committed to helping you succeed. If you encounter any issues or have questions about the setup, please refer to the included documentation or contact our support team.

What's Your Reaction?

Like Like 0
Dislike Dislike 0
Love Love 0
Funny Funny 0
Angry Angry 0
Sad Sad 0
Wow Wow 0